Angela Ruckdeschel, MSN, RN
Biography
I am currently a full-time PhD student on the nursing education track at University of Las Vegas, Nevada. My research interest is in exploring the use of academic electronic health records in better preparing undergraduate nursing students for clinical rotations and eventually professional practice. Before academics, my career was in oncology and hospice nursing. My work experience includes overseeing a graduate nurse program in an outpatient oncology setting and as a hospice nurse educator where I was responsible for developing a graduate nurse internship program. It was through these experiences that I discovered my passion for teaching and returned to school. I am currently a member of Sigma Theta Tau International Honor Society of Nursing, Golden Key International Honor Society, and the Graduate Nursing Student Association. Recent awards include Outstanding Graduate Student Award in 2015, Lahr Scholarship recipient in 2014 and 2015, and a Graduate Assistantship for the upcoming academic year 2016-2017.
